Buying Guide for Transmission High Lift Jack
Understanding What a Transmission High Lift Jack Is
When I first started working on my vehicle, I quickly realized the importance of having the right jack. A transmission high lift jack is designed to lift heavy vehicles by engaging the transmission or frame, allowing for easier maintenance or tire changes. It’s especially useful for trucks and SUVs with higher ground clearance.
Assessing Your Vehicle’s Weight and Lift Height
One of the first things I considered was my vehicle’s weight and the height I needed to lift it. Not all jacks can handle every vehicle, so I made sure to choose one with a lifting capacity that exceeds my vehicle’s weight. Additionally, I checked the maximum lift height to ensure it could raise the vehicle high enough for my needs.
Material and Build Quality
I wanted a jack that was durable and reliable, so I looked for one made from heavy-duty steel. A sturdy build gives me confidence that the jack won’t fail under pressure. I also checked for corrosion-resistant finishes since I use my jack outdoors in various weather conditions.
Safety Features to Look For
Safety is critical when lifting a vehicle. I made sure the jack had a secure base to prevent slipping and a reliable locking mechanism to hold the vehicle in place once lifted. Some models include safety pins or overload protection, which adds an extra layer of security.
Ease of Use and Portability
Since I often work alone, I valued a jack that was easy to operate without requiring excessive strength. A smooth lifting mechanism and ergonomic handle made a big difference. I also considered the weight and size of the jack for storage and transport, ensuring I could easily carry it in my truck.
